The Darkwoods Mission
Darkwoods Paranormal Society is a small paranormal research group. Our mission is to investigate reports of the paranormal to further our understanding of this little known subject, as well as educate people regarding the paranormal, supernatural or unexplained. To that end, DPS holds a few key tenets to insure that we remain true to ourselves, our clients, and the general public.
DPS approaches every case from a skeptical point of view. This is perhaps the most important principle any paranormal investigator should have. DPS will always search for the most rational explanation first. Many groups will immediately view any anomaly, dust on a picture, or reflection in a window as a "ghost". We never claim to have found evidence of a ghost. We simply state that we found something that we could not explain through a rational explanation.
DPS investigators have a lot of experience, but we are not experts. A lot of groups claim to be "certified" in the paranormal field. They are untruthful. There is no way to become "certified" because there is still no way to conclusively verify any claim of the paranormal. This is why we investigate the paranormal, to look for answers in the hopes that someday, we will have the answers. We always try to replicate results. We always try to test our theories, and we will never come to a conclusion about those theories until they are thoroughly tested. We never claim any "cause and effect" relationships. We only point out correlations.
DPS investigators are not ghost busters. We cannot rid a location of "ghosts" or "spirits,". We also do not do exorcisms, seances, or cleansings. We would never claim to be able to rid a house of a phenomenon, but if needed we would work with you to find someone who possibly can.
DPS does not trespass. This is a matter of respect for our clients, as well as ourselves. We do not investigate any location without full permission by the owners. For one, it can be very dangerous to investigate abandoned locations, and there have been too many stories in the news lately about suspected "ghost hunters" being arrested, injured, or even killed while trespassing in dangerous buildings. Secondly, it is disrespectful and in most cases, illegal.
DPS does not charge for its services. There are many groups who charge clients for their services or evidence disks, or for training courses to become a "certified" paranormal investigator. Or there are so-called psychics and mediums who charge people money to "cleanse" their home. Because there are no experts in this field, and because not much is known about paranormal phenomena, DPS does not charge for any of its services. Anyone who charges money should be avoided at all costs. The only thing you will gain from paying for their services is a smaller bank account.

Objectives
To investigate the reality of the existence of paranormal phenomena, to try to ascertain the characteristic properties of such phenomena by scientifically acceptable means, and to attempt to find scientific explanations for such phenomena.
To promote research into paranormal phenomena by fostering cooperation between ourselves and interested individuals, or other research institutions dealing with such phenomena.
To render assistance to members of the public with problems arising out of possible paranormal experiences.
To gather information on paranormal phenomena through audio and visual means.
